    What type of dimmer will I need?
    In my kitchen I have 2 wall switches, side by side. They are decora switches. One controls some internal cabinet lighting and one controls a hanging light fixture over the dining table. I want to change out the existing switch for the hanging light with a sliding dimmer. I know the kind I want (decora) but when I checked there are several different kinds. I don't know which one I need, I don't think I need the 3 Way kind. Can anyone help me make the correct choice before I buy a dimmer. Thank you.

    Sounds like maybe S-600. Single pole
    S-600 P Has "P"reset switch Single Pole
    S-603 P Has "P"reset switch Three Way
